Floundering Warheads Lose 8th Straight
The performance of Joe Madden proved critical in helping Bompton beat Amarillo, 7-6. The Baby Lakers right fielder went 3-5 with 3 doubles. He scored 2 times and drove in 2. Jonathan Alexander, credited with the win, is now 1-0. He allowed no runs on no hits. The win takes Bompton to 5-8.

The game came to a dramatic end. In the bottom of the ninth, with Bompton trailing 6-4, Jimmy Dreux hit a knuckle curve from António Gómez for a 3-run home run, giving the Baby Lakers the walk-off win.

Madden described the clubhouse as "kind of rowdy" after the game.
